The Haryana Government is set to fill 24,800 vacancies in Group C and D categories through the Common Eligibility Test (CET)-2025, in what is being seen as one of the largest recruitment drives in the state.

Advertisement

A government spokesperson said the CET, held on July 26 and 27, witnessed a massive 13.48 lakh candidates appearing across the state. The exams were conducted smoothly with the help of AI-based monitoring, free transportation, overnight accommodation and coordinated efforts by district officials, ensuring a hassle-free experience for candidates.
